MATTER OF AWAD v. FORDHAM UNIV.

Index No. 153826/17. Appeal No. 12698. Case No. 2020-00843.

189 A.D.3d 605 (2020)

139 N.Y.S.3d 154

2020 NY Slip Op 07695

In the Matter of Ahmad Awad et al., Respondents, v. Fordham University, Appellant.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, First Department.

Decided December 22, 2020.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Cullen and Dykman LLP, Garden City ( James G. Ryan of counsel), for appellant.

Maria C. LaHood and Alan Levine , Center for Constitutional Rights, New York, for respondents.

Aaron Eitan Meyer , Hauppauge, for Standwithus, amicus curiae.

Herbst Law PLLC, New York ( Robert L. Herbst of counsel), for Jewish Studies Scholars, amici curiae.

Concur—Friedman, J.P., Renwick, Singh, Kennedy, Shulman, JJ.


The motion to amend the petition should have been denied, as petitioner Shetty, who was not a student at respondent university when the original petitioners' application for recognition of a student club was rejected, lacks standing to challenge a determination that caused him no injury in fact (see New York State Assn. of Nurse Anesthetists v Novello, 2 N.Y.3d 207, 211 [2004]).
